International Assets Investment Management LLC Purchases New Shares in Helmerich & Payne, Inc. (NYSE:HP)

International Assets Investment Management LLC bought a new position in Helmerich & Payne, Inc. (NYSE:HPFree Report) during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und bought 8,787 shares of the oil and gas company’s stock, valued at approximately $318,000.

Helmerich & Payne Stock Down 0.1 %

Helmerich & Payne stock opened at $40.41 on Friday. The stock has a market cap of $3.99 billion, a PE ratio of 11.55,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.03 and a beta of 1.51.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.20, a quick ratio of 1.89 and a current ratio of 2.11. Helmerich & Payne, Inc. has a one year low of $30.41 and a one year high of $46.55. The stock has a fifty day moving average of $40.75 and a 200 day moving average of $38.71.

Helmerich & Payne (NYSE:HPG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, January 30th. The oil and gas company reported $0.97 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.73 by $0.24. The business had revenue of $677.00 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$661.81 million. Helmerich & Payne had a return on equity of 13.28% and a net margin of 12.84%. The business’s quarterly revenue was down 6.0%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$1.11 earnings per share.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Helmerich & Payne, Inc. will post 3.59 EPS for the current year.

Helmerich & Payne Dividend Announcement

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, May 31st. Shareholders of record on Friday, May 17th will be given a $0.42 dividend. This represents a $1.68 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 4.16%.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, May 16th. Helmerich & Payne’s payout ratio is 28.57%.
